This sounds like what I'm looking for as a natural alternative to the color I just did last month. Would you mind PMing or sharing the exact products and procedures you used for the coffee/henna blend? TIA.
 
No problem. Very easy. All you need is henna, already brewed coffee (not grounds) and I also added coconut oil and some cheapie conditioner oh and indigo.

First I put the henna in a bowl and then added the coffee to make a past. Let sit over night

Next morning in a separate bowl I put some indigo in a bowl used warm water to make a paste. Let sit for 15 min.

Combine henna, indigo, cheapie conditioner, and oil mix and apply. I let sit on my hair for 3.5 hours.

When I washed it out my hair was so soft.

I hope this helps. If you need anymore info just PM me.
